The detailed syllabus for Theory of Metal Cutting M.Tech 2017-2018 (R17) first year first sem is as follows.
M.Tech. I Year I Sem.
Unit -I : Mechanics of Metal Cutting: Geometry of Metal Cutting Process, Chip formation, Chip thickness ratio, radius of chip curvature, cutting speed, feed and depth of cut – Types of chips chip breakers. Orthogonal and Oblique cutting processes – definition, Forces and energy calculations (Merchant’s Analysis) – Power consumed – MRR- Effect of Cutting variables on Forces, Force measurement using Dynamometers.
Unit – II : Single Point Cutting Tool: Various systems of specifications, single point cutting tool geometry and their inter-relation. Theories of formation of built-up edge and their effect, design of single point contact tools throwaway inserts.
Unit – III : Multi point Cutting Tool: Drill geometry, design of drills, Rake& Relief angles of twist drill, speed, feed and depth of cut, machining time, forces, milling cutters, cutting speed &feed machining time design – from cutters. Grinding: Specifications of grinding of grinding wheel, mechanics of grinding, Effect of Grinding conditions on wheel wear and grinding ratio. Depth of cut, speed, machining time, temperature power.
Unit – IV : Tool Life and Tool Wear: Theories of tool wear – adhesion, abrasive and diffusion wear mechanisms, forms of wear, Tool life criteria and machin ability index Types of sliding contact, real area of contact, laws of friction and nature of frictional force in metal cutting. Effect Tool angle, Economics, cost analysis, mean co-effect of friction.
Unit – V : Cutting Temperature: Sources of heat in metal cutting, influence of metal conditions, Temperature distribution, zones, experimental techniques, analytical approach. Use of tool- work thermocouple for determination of temperature. Temperature distribution in Metal Cutting. Cutting fluids: Functions of cutting fluids, types of cutting fluids, properties, selection of cutting fluids. Cutting tool materials: Historical developments, essential properties of cutting tool materials, types, composition and application of various cutting tool materials, selection of cutting tool materials.
